I've tried the Vortex, and several other iterations of the same theme. Definitely get something else.
Look at the Outdoorsman, MUTNT, or Field Optics Research. Those three have a feature in common that is a "stud" which stays attached and doesn't poke you in the chest while hanging around your neck. That stud mounts to a center post which stays mounted on the tripod . Not a lot of experience with the three, so can't compare between them; I have only used one of them, but they all seem pretty similar.
